This print by Hugh Rooney showcases the iconic Harland and Wolff cranes, Samson and Goliath, in Belfast's Queens Island. Standing tall against the vibrant blue sky, these colossal structures represent not only a testament to 20th-century architecture but also an integral part of Belfast's rich history. The image captures the intricate patterns and shapes formed by the steel frames of these gantry cranes, highlighting their impressive engineering. As symbols of Belfast's maritime heritage, they serve as a gateway to its bustling harbor and thriving shipyard. Visitors from all over the world are drawn to this historic site, which has become one of Northern Ireland's most popular tourist attractions.
